RESPONSIBILITY MAPPING OF EACH TIER OF LSGIS IN RESPECT OF MANDATORY AND GENERAL FUNCTIONS DEVOLVED

Funding Agency: Decentralization Support Programme, Department of Local Self Government, Kerala

The overlaps in the functional domain of State Government and Local Self Governments (LSGs) and among different tiers of LSGs particularly in sectors like agriculture and allied sectors have resulted in higher tiers of LSGs performing functions which ought to have been performed by the lower tier. To identify the overlap of functional areas, clear cut demarcation of functional domain of each tier of Panchayats and State Government is required. There is clarity regarding the functions and responsibilities in infrastructure sector and the activities regarding the service sector is more or less clear. But there is little clarity regarding the functions and responsibilities of economic development sectors. The objective of the project were to make suggestions for enlisting the functional responsibilities of each tier / type of LSGIs as enunciated in the enactments, to demarcate the functional domain of the Local Government and State Government / Departments based on the experiences, to prepare Responsibility Matrix in respect of each tier / type of Local Government and Government

The actual mapping of responsibilities and functions were done by the 18 Working Groups constituted by the State Planning Board in each sector for the purpose. The activity has been taken up as a Technical Assistance programme under the Decentralisation Support Programme of the Department of Local Self Government, Kerala. Workshops of the Working Group were organized to discuss and finalise the allocation of responsibilities.
